December 15th- the Huron Elks Hoop Shoot will be held at the Middle School Gym.  The Elks National "Hoop Shoot" contest is open to all boys and girls ages 8-13.  It is a free throw shooting competition.  There are 3 competing age groups for boys and girls ages 8-9, 10-11, and 12-13 yr's old.  Contestant age groups are determined by their ages as of April 1, 2019.
-Registration will start at 10:00 AM, and the contest if free to participate in

The qualifying winners from this contest will be eligible to compete at the State Elks "Hoop Shoot" Contest, which will be held Saturday, February 2nd 2019 at the Georgia Morse Middle School in Pierre, SD.
